[0006] The invention adopts a mixer, a twin-screw extruder, a single-screw extruder, a double-drawing electric heating drafting machine, a wire receiving machine using a torque motor, a spinning machine, and a spinning-grade dry high-density polyethylene (HDPE) Resin, nano-scale dry titanium dioxide (TiO2) for spinning and turpentine additives for spinning, after sieving, spinning-grade dry HDPE resin, nano-scale dry TiO2 for spinning 2 Mixed with turpentine additives for spinning, the melt index of spinning-grade dry HDPE resin should meet 0.6g / 10min~1.5g / 10min (if the HDPE resin is damp, it should be dried, dried in the sun or air-dried); Nanoscale dry TiO for silk 2 The average particle size is not more than 60nm, and the amount added is 0.5‰~2.2‰ of the weight of spinning-grade dry HDPE resin (if nano-TiO 2 If the material is damp, it should be dried); the amount of turpentine additives for spinning is 0.3% to 0.4% of the weight of spinning-grade dry HDPE resin; spinning-...
